Bigtable provides two in-memory caches: one for row/column data and one for
disk block caches.
The size of each cache should be configurable, data should be loaded lazily,
and the cache managed by an LRU mechanism.
One complication of the block cache is that all data is read through a
SequenceFile.Reader which ultimately reads data off of disk via a RPC proxy for
ClientProtocol. This would imply that the block caching would have to be pushed
down to either the DFSClient or SequenceFile.Reader
